Sq. Enix has issued an announcement denying it’s exploring taking the corporate personal after a report in Japanese enterprise journal Sentaku claimed the writer had drawn curiosity from overseas funding funds.
“The September problem of the month-to-month journal Sentaku carried a report relating to the opportunity of Sq. Enix Holdings Co., Ltd. (the ‘Firm’) going personal,” the corporate wrote in a succinct statement. “Nonetheless, this data was not introduced by the Firm.
“No consideration is at present being given throughout the Firm to taking the Firm personal.”
The Sentaku report despatched Sq. Enix’s inventory surging on the Tokyo Inventory Alternate, rising as a lot as 8.3 % all through the day, in response to Investing.com (thanks, Eurogamer).
Activist investor 3D Funding Companions, which holds roughly 18.5 % of Sq. Enix’s shares, allegedly sparked this hypothesis. It has previously pushed the company’s board to reassess its strategy.
Sq. Enix has spent the previous 4 years restructuring, promoting Western studios Crystal Dynamics, Eidos Montreal, and Sq. Enix Montreal to Embracer Group in 2022, then laying off more than 100 staff across the US and UK in 2025 as a part of a consolidation of improvement in Japan.
A take-private deal would require shopping for again all excellent shares at a premium. Saudi Arabia’s Public Funding Fund took an identical path with its acquisition of Electronic Arts, a deal that left EA in billions of {dollars} in debt.
Square Enix reported strong first-quarter growth earlier this month, with revenue rising 175.5% to ¥13.2 billion ($82.9 million). The corporate attributed these outcomes to its Digital Leisure phase, which noticed excessive gross sales in HD Video games, MMO, and Good Units/PC Browser sub-segments.
